Transaction 2988521d53645deadc2455a1450a5654369c28679b7683b7d4b78d9f53531048
1 Input
1 Output
-
2988521d53645deadc2455a1450a5654369c28679b7683b7d4b78d9f53531048:0
- value
- 456901
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e25b96d5d5fc73cab24f3c022547a3b52397939 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B3QXEYACsNF5HzpB7t9QxV67SoHprzBKs